Starting Point: Car park, Llyn Cwm Dulyn (SH 488 498)
Terrain: Grassy uphill path, rocky scramble near summit
This is a straightforward linear walk to Mynydd Graig Goch(Hewitt) that needed to be done so I could tick it off my "Hewitt's to do list" it offers excellent views of the reservoir, impressive crags, and wider Snowdonia landscape. The grassy path provides easy walking until the final rocky scramble to the summit. A short but rewarding walk that can be completed in a few hours, making it ideal for a half-day outing with stunning views throughout.
